MySQL Workbench初学者教程:创建订单系统数据库【示例详解】
版权申诉
33 浏览量
更新于2024-04-05
收藏 2.66MB PDF 举报
MySQL Workbench 是 MySQL AB 最近释放的可视数据库设计工具,它是专门用于设计 MySQL 数据库的工具。本文作者 Djoni Darmawikarta 通过一个订单系统的示例来展示 MySQL Workbench 的一些功能和特性。在这个示例中,我们将创建一个物理数据模型,该模型可以是销售订单系统或其他类型的订单系统,并且我们将使用 forward-engineer(正向引擎)来将这个模型生成为一个 MySQL 数据库。
在 MySQL Workbench 中建立的物理数据模型被称为针对特定 RDBMS 产品(如 MySQL)的模型。这个模型将遵循 MySQL 的独特规范,并且除了包含表和列(字段)外,还可以包含视图等对象。通过 MySQL Workbench,我们可以轻松地生成数据库对象,从而通过 forward-engineer 的功能来将我们的物理数据模型转化为一个完整的 MySQL 数据库。
MySQL Workbench 提供了许多功能和工具,其中包括数据库设计、模型比较、SQL 开发等功能。通过 MySQL Workbench,用户可以方便地进行数据库设计和管理,而无需编写复杂的 SQL 语句。通过可视化的界面,用户可以在 MySQL Workbench 中创建表、定义列、设置主键和外键等操作,从而快速构建复杂的数据库结构。
除了数据库设计功能外,MySQL Workbench 还提供了模型比较工具,用户可以使用这个功能来比较不同版本的数据模型,并进行差异对比。这个功能对于团队协作和版本管理非常有用,可以帮助用户快速定位数据库模型的变化并进行合并或回滚操作。
此外,MySQL Workbench 还提供了 SQL 开发功能,用户可以通过这个功能来编写和执行 SQL 查询、存储过程、触发器等。通过 SQL 开发工具,用户可以轻松地进行数据库操作,实现数据的增删改查等功能。
总的来说,MySQL Workbench 是一个功能强大的可视数据库设计工具,可以帮助初学者快速学习和掌握 MySQL 数据库的设计和管理。通过 MySQL Workbench,用户可以轻松地创建物理数据模型、生成数据库对象,并进行数据库设计和开发工作。如果你正在学习 MySQL 数据库,那么 MySQL Workbench 绝对是一个值得推荐的工具,它将为你的学习和工作带来很大的便利和帮助。
2021-10-12 上传
2021-10-11 上传
2023-04-05 上传
2023-04-05 上传
2022-11-01 上传
2023-04-05 上传
hwx18537729388
- 粉丝: 1
- 资源: 9万+
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查